There are four Shiba Inu coat colors that are officially recognized by both Japanese and American Shiba organizations. The coat colors are: Red. Black and Tan. Sesame. Cream. However there are actually a lot more variances of Shiba Inu coat colors that are affected by genes. Pinto Shiba Inu.

The black hairs should have bronze cast while the undercoat can be either buff or gray. A black and tan Shiba Inu should be a very high contrast colored dog with distinct and defined black and tan markings. The tan markings should only occur between black and white areas restricted to the eye spots, cheeks, inside of ears, legs and tail.

The black and tan Shiba Inu colors are very easy to identify due to the triple colors on its coat. The three colors on its coat have a black foundation with brown spots and a white Urajiro pattern. A single strand must have three types to be true black and tan. After the red colored coat, black and tan are one of the most common colors for this.

The black and tan Shiba Inu is a stunning variation of the Shiba Inu breed, known for their distinctive coat color and markings. Their coat is predominantly black, with a tan or rust-colored fur on their cheeks, eyebrows, legs, chest, and underbelly. The black and tan Shiba Inu has a compact and sturdy build, with erect ears and a curly tail.

Red, black and tan, cream, sesame, black sesame, red sesame. The Shiba Inu ( 柴犬, Japanese: [ɕiba inɯ]) is a breed of hunting dog from Japan. A small-to-medium breed, it is the smallest of the six original breed of dogs native to Japan. [1] Its name literally translates to "brushwood dog", as it is used to flush game.

The Earliest Records of Black & Tan Shiba Inu in History. The Shiba Inu is an ancient breed with a history that stretches back almost 2,000 years. However, while there were likely black and tan Shiba Inus then, it took quite a while longer for breeders to start selectively breeding specifically for these colors.

The Black And Tan Shiba Inu has a rich history that dates back to the early 20th century. The purebred Shiba Inus almost became extinct because of years of wars, disease, and the introduction of Western dogs. After World War II, initiatives were made to breed together 3 Japanese dog breeds, namely the San'in Shiba, Mino Shiba, and Shinshu Shiba, to form the Shiba Inu that we know today.

Black and tan Shiba Inus cost around 250,000 to 450,000 yen in Japan. Meanwhile, in the U.S., they cost approximately $1,500 to $2,200 from a reputable breeder. This price range may even be higher if you decide to register them fully. Since black sesame Shibas are very rare, breeders usually sell them at a high price.

3. Black and Tan Shiba Inus Have a Cat-like Personality. Black and tan Shiba Inus, like other varieties of the breed, are indeed known for their cat-like personalities. They are independent, intelligent, and very clean, much like cats. Shiba Inus also have a reputation for being somewhat aloof and independent.

The Black & Tan Shiba Inu is compact, muscular, and well-balanced. They typically weigh between 17 to 23 pounds for males and 15 to 20 pounds for females, standing about 14.5 to 16.5 inches tall.
